Heatline F27 Fault Code: Causes, Fixes & Repair Costs

What does the Heatline F27 fault code mean?

The F27 fault code appears when the boiler's flame supervision system detects an anomaly with the burner flame — specifically, the boiler has opened the gas valve and attempted to light, but the flame detection circuit either reports no stable flame or registers a flame signal at the wrong time. The result is an immediate lockout: both central heating and hot water stop working until the fault is cleared. Because Heatline is part of the Vaillant Group, the F27 code carries the same meaning across Heatline and Vaillant boilers — if you have a Capriz, Advance, or Kalder model, the diagnostic approach is identical to the Vaillant ecoTEC range.

How to fix it

  1. Reset the boiler once or twice DIY safe

    Press and hold the reset button (usually marked with a flame or reset symbol on the display panel) for approximately three seconds. Wait for the boiler to complete a full start-up cycle. If it fires up and runs normally, monitor it over the next few hours. A one-off ignition glitch can occasionally clear this way. If the F27 returns promptly, do not keep resetting — repeated resets will not fix an underlying fault and can mask a developing problem.

  2. Confirm your gas supply is working DIY safe

    Check that other gas appliances in the property — such as the hob or gas fire — are lighting normally. If nothing gas-powered is working, contact your gas supplier (National Gas Emergency: 0800 111 999) rather than attempting any boiler work. If other appliances are working fine, the supply to the property is not the issue.

  3. Inspect underneath the boiler for condensate drips DIY safe

    Look at the white plastic condensate trap and the area directly below the boiler casing for any signs of water staining, drips, or wet marks. You do not need to open the boiler casing to do this — just look at what is visible from outside. If you can see active dripping onto or near the boiler, note its location and mention it to the engineer, as this is a strong indicator that moisture is the root cause of the F27.

  4. Do not attempt to open the boiler casing or touch internal components Gas Safe engineer

    All work inside the boiler — including inspecting or cleaning the flame sensor, testing the ignition electrodes, checking the gas valve, or examining the PCB — must be carried out by a Gas Safe registered engineer. Opening the casing and working on gas or high-voltage components without Gas Safe registration is illegal and dangerous.

  5. Have a Gas Safe engineer inspect and test the ignition and flame detection system Gas Safe engineer

    An engineer will remove the casing and use a multimeter to test the ignition leads, electrodes, and flame sensor for correct resistance and continuity. They will check the electrode gap and condition, clean or replace the ionisation probe, and inspect all wiring connections to the PCB for corrosion or moisture damage.

  6. Gas Safe engineer to assess the gas valve and combustion Gas Safe engineer

    If the ignition and sensor components check out, the engineer will test the gas valve for correct operation and gas rate, and may carry out a combustion analysis to confirm the burner is performing within safe parameters. A drifting or faulty gas valve will need to be replaced — this is a gas-carrying component and is not DIY-repairable under any circumstances.

  7. Gas Safe engineer to assess the PCB if other components are serviceable Gas Safe engineer

    If moisture damage to the PCB is confirmed, the engineer may be able to dry and clean the board if the fault is caught early. If the board has failed, a replacement PCB will be required. On a boiler over eight to ten years old, the engineer should advise you to weigh the PCB replacement cost against the cost of a new boiler installation, as these can be comparable.

  8. Call a Gas Safe registered engineer if the fault has not been resolved Gas Safe engineer

    If the reset and basic checks above have not resolved the F27, contact a Gas Safe registered engineer. You can verify any engineer's registration at gassaferegister.co.uk. Do not continue to run or reset a boiler that is repeatedly locking out on F27, as this indicates an underlying combustion or electrical fault that needs professional diagnosis.

Typical repair cost

Expect to pay roughly £150–£400, depending on the underlying cause.

Frequently asked questions

Can I fix the Heatline F27 fault myself?

The safe DIY steps are limited to resetting the boiler once or twice, confirming your gas supply is on, and checking for visible condensate drips beneath the boiler casing. Everything beyond that — inspecting the electrodes, cleaning the flame sensor, testing or replacing the gas valve, or any work involving the PCB — legally requires a Gas Safe registered engineer. Removing the boiler casing and working on gas or high-voltage components without Gas Safe registration is illegal in the UK.

How much does it cost to repair an F27 fault on a Heatline boiler?

Most F27 repairs fall between £150 and £400 including parts and labour once a call-out has been made. Simple jobs such as replacing an ignition electrode or cleaning the flame sensor sit at the lower end of that range. A gas valve replacement typically costs £200–£350 all-in. PCB replacement is more expensive — usually £350–£500 including parts and labour — and if your boiler is over eight to ten years old, it is worth comparing that figure against the cost of a new boiler installation before committing to the repair.

Why does my Heatline boiler keep coming back with F27 even after a reset?

If the F27 returns within minutes of a reset, or keeps recurring over days or weeks, it is a strong sign that there is an underlying component fault rather than a one-off ignition glitch. The most common repeating causes are moisture on the PCB from a leaking condensate trap, a deteriorating ignition electrode, or a gas valve that is drifting out of calibration. Repeated resets without fixing the root cause will not resolve the problem and may mask a worsening fault — you should call a Gas Safe engineer rather than continuing to reset.

Is the Heatline F27 the same fault code as on a Vaillant boiler?

Yes. Heatline is part of the Vaillant Group, and the Capriz, Advance, and Kalder models share design heritage and fault code logic with the Vaillant ecoTEC range. The F27 code means exactly the same thing on both brands — an incorrect or missing flame signal causing a lockout — and the diagnostic and repair approach is identical. An engineer experienced with Vaillant ecoTEC boilers will be equally capable of working on a Heatline carrying this fault.
